Arthroscopic-Assisted Core Decompression for Osteonecrosis of the Femoral Head

open access: yesArthroscopy Techniques, 2014
The management of pre-collapse osteonecrosis of the femoral head is controversial. Core decompression is a technique that theoretically decreases the intraosseous pressure of the femoral head, resulting in a local vascularized healing response.
